Episode Description: In this deeply moving episode of The Collectives Conversations, we sit down with Davey Blackburn, founder of Nothing Is Wasted Ministries and author of Nothing Is Wasted: A True Story of Hope, Forgiveness, and Finding Purpose in Pain. Davey shares the heartbreaking story of losing his wife Amanda and their unborn child in a senseless act of violence. Through raw honesty and unwavering faith, Davey opens up about the intense hurt, loss, and anger he faced—and how God walked with him through the darkest valley of his life.

Davey's story is one of redemption and hope, showing that even in the most painful circumstances, God's presence can bring healing and restoration. Join us as we explore how Davey found the strength to forgive, the courage to rebuild, and the purpose to help others navigate their own seasons of grief and suffering.

Key Discussion Points:

  • The tragic loss of Davey’s wife Amanda and their unborn child.
  • How Davey grappled with overwhelming grief, anger, and doubt.
  • The turning point in Davey’s journey where he began to find hope and healing.
  • The role of faith and community in overcoming life's darkest moments.
  • Davey's mission through Nothing Is Wasted Ministries to help others find purpose in their pain.
